/* | |||
* Force NKRO | |||
* | |||
* Force NKRO (nKey Rollover) to be enabled by default, regardless of the saved | |||
* state in the bootmagic EEPROM settings. (Note that NKRO must be enabled in the | |||
* makefile for this to work.) | |||
* | |||
* If forced on, NKRO can be disabled via magic key (default = LShift+RShift+N) | |||
* until the next keyboard reset. | |||
* | |||
* NKRO may prevent your keystrokes from being detected in the BIOS, but it is | |||
* fully operational during normal computer usage. | |||
* | |||
* For a less heavy-handed approach, enable NKRO via magic key (LShift+RShift+N) | |||
* or via bootmagic (hold SPACE+N while plugging in the keyboard). Once set by | |||
* bootmagic, NKRO mode will always be enabled until it is toggled again during a | |||
* power-up. | |||
* | |||
*/ | |||
//#define FORCE_NKRO | |||

# KB58 | |||
![kb58_pico](https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/25994266/146207912-b725e22f-92dc-4a40-9157-c2fddff45ce2.jpg) | |||
This is 58 keys keyboard. | |||
* Keyboard Maintainer: [beanaccle](https://github.com/beanaccle) | |||
* Hardware Supported: KB58 | |||
* Hardware Availability: [KB58 Pico](https://github.com/beanaccle/kb58_pico) | |||
Make example for this keyboard (after setting up your build environment): | |||
make kb58:default | |||
## Bootloader | |||
Enter the bootloader in 3 ways: | |||
* **Bootmagic reset**: Hold down the key at (0,0) in the matrix (usually the top left key or Escape) and plug in the keyboard | |||
* **Physical reset button**: Briefly press the button on the back of the PCB - some may have pads you must short instead | |||
* **Keycode in layout**: Press the key mapped to `RESET` if it is available | |||
See the [build environment setup](https://docs.qmk.fm/#/getting_started_build_tools) and the [make instructions](https://docs.qmk.fm/#/getting_started_make_guide) for more information. Brand new to QMK? Start with our [Complete Newbs Guide](https://docs.qmk.fm/#/newbs). |
